University students in Turkey’s east ‘colored’ in festival

Within the scope of the "Fırat Fest," a 20-day spring festival organized by Fırat University, a "Color Festival" was held in the eastern province of Elazığ for the first time.

Some 5,000 university students participated in the "Color Festival," held in a social complex by the Lake Hazar and threw powdered paint at each other.

Rowing on Bosphorus latest popular trend

Rowing in Istanbul's Golden Horn has become the new sports trend in Turkey's biggest metropolis, with a number of people willing to join an outdoor activity rather than staying indoors following the coronavirus pandemic.

"The growth rate of this sport has increased by five times through the pandemic," Fırat Fırat, a rowing instructor at Haliç Rowing Club, said on April 24.

Medical student studies at library he once worked as laborer

A medical student is now studying in the very same university's library where he once worked as a construction worker in 2017 in the eastern province of Elazığ.

"I have gained success after real hard work. I am happy, and this is a fantastic feeling," 23-year-old Hasan Coşkun told the Demirören News Agency.

Turkish celebs help UN get word out about coronavirus

Turkish celebrities are helping the U.N. get the word out about coronavirus with their legions of followers and new audiences, the World Health Organization said on May 7.
The WHO said that live broadcasts with famous Turkish celebrities such as actress Tuba Büyüküstün are being posted across various social media platforms, including Instagram and YouTube.

Prosecutor demands extension of arrest of suspects in Gülen's media links case

Prosecutors have demanded an extension of the imprisonment of the suspects in the case on the Fethullahist Terrorist Organization's (FETÖ) media leg, in which former pop singer Atilla Taş and writer Gökçe Fırat Çulhaoğlu are imprisoned along with 12 other suspects.

The case continued with its third hearing at the Istanbul 25th Heavy Criminal Court on Aug. 18.

Chief physician of university hospital in Turkey's Elazığ killed in armed attack

A chief physician of the Fırat University Hospital in the eastern province of Elazığ was killed in an armed attack on May 24, Doğan News Agency has reported.

Professor Muhammed Said Berilgen was assaulted by the owner of a medical firm, identified as Sercan Gök, while he was in his office at 11.45 p.m.
